Aritmetic series:
Sn= n/2* (2a+(n-1)b)
disini (here)
1+2+3+...+100
a= 1 suku Pertama (firts Unit)
b=1 selisih ( diffrerent near units. example : b= 2-1 = 1 b=3-2=1 )
n=100 banyaknya suku ( amount of units)

Sn= n/2 (2a+(n-1)b)
S 100= 100/2 (2*1+(100-1)*1)
S100= 50 (2+99*1)
S100= 50 (2+99)
S100= 50 * 101
S100= 50 * 101
S100= 5050

simple formula for this series
Sn= n/2 *(2+(n-1)1)
Sn= n/2 *(2+n-1)
Sn= n/2 *(n+1) or
Sn= 1/2*n* (n+1)
